Pezeshkian calls memorandum with U.S. historic

Pezeshkian calls memorandum with U.S. historic
18.06.2026 18:00

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ian called a memorandum of understanding signed with the United States historic, saying it was aimed at ending hostilities and reopening the Strait of Hormuz.

“This is a historic document and a message from a strong Iran: peace becomes real through mutual respect,” Pezeshkian wrote, attaching the English-language text of the memorandum.

The United States and Iran signed the memorandum overnight on June 18. The document was signed by U.S. President Donald Trump and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ian.
